Starting in 2021, the UUA Office at the United Nations is proud to recognize Sixth Principle Congregations that show their support of our UU Sixth Principle goal of "world community with peace, liberty, and justice for all." A prior version of this award recognized "Blue Ribbon Congregations" between 2009-2020. Below is a map of congregations that have become Blue Ribbon Congregations, with the year noted that they most recently received the award.
